Sec. 2. (a) ELTF claims must be submitted in
accordance with rules adopted by the financial assurance board under
IC 13-23-11-7(a)(1)(B).
(b) If the administrator denies an ELTF claim, the administrator
shall provide the claimant with a written explanation of all reasons for
the denial of reimbursement.
(c) The administrator shall forward a copy of a claim approved
under this section to the state comptroller not more than seven (7) days
after approving the claim.
(d) Not more than thirty (30) days after receiving a copy of an
approved ELTF claim under subsection (c), the state comptroller shall
pay the ELTF claim to the claimant from the ELTF.
[Pre-1996 Recodification Citations: 13-7-20-37;
13-7-20-39(a).]
As added by P.L.1-1996, SEC.13. Amended by P.L.9-1996,
SEC.22; P.L.14-2001, SEC.15; P.L.96-2016, SEC.34; P.L.9-2024,
SEC.345.
